TIP: When using your screen to find a country or match a picture, the recognition capabilities work great! If you aren’t able to make the match right away, try tilting your screen slightly to make the adjustment. We found that coming towards the globe from a higher perspective always seemed to do the trick.

6 Different Ways Interact with the Globe

Have you ever gotten to feed a koala? Well now you can say you have! Within the app, there are different categories that you can choose to learn about. Animals is one of our favorites as you get to choose what to feed the animal in the country you’re learning about. Be careful to use the knowledge you’ve been given and your troubleshooting to make sure the animal gets fed correctly! Other categories include monuments, cultures, maps, weather, and inventions.

Match, match, match

My three year old loves to play the matching game! The app will give a a picture of a monument to search for and clues to help find it (Example clues: It is near the ocean or It is in Asia.)  Simply by lining of the picture on her screen with the image on the globe makes her CORRECT! She is instantly proud of herself and the learning that is taking place is REAL and EXCITING.

What is Augmented Reality? AR is an interactive technology that combines a real-world environment with a computer-generated visual. How does Augmented Reality make learning fun? It helps children to stay engaged in what is being taught. In fact, they will be so enthralled in playing that they’ll never even know that learning is taking place. Shhhhhh! Don’t tell!
